Ranger, Revolutionizing Software Testing

We’re building Ranger to change the status quo of QA. Our mission is to power testing for the world’s most ambitious engineering, product, and design teams so they can get back to building. 

How We’re Already Changing the Game:

Intelligent Test Generation

Leveraging advanced LLMs, we automatically generate reliable and efficient Playwright tests.

Self-Healing Tests

Our system proactively identifies and resolves flaky tests, ensuring consistent and reliable test suites.

Improved failure insights

Get automated failure reports with likely causes, and easy-to-follow steps to reproduce the issue.

What we are looking for
  • Getting back on defense for each other: No one at Ranger works on an island. When someone needs to step out or gets overwhelmed, we reach out to help rather than look to blame. We always put the team above ourselves out of trust that our teammates would do the same.
  • Creative problem solving: we are an early stage start-up, everyone is expected to work together to solve problems even if it might not usually fall within your job description.
  • Pride in your work: it is still critical to be proud of the work you and your peers are producing. Our pride should stem from craftsmanship and the value it brings customers. Part of this is preferring code to be live over perfect and finding the right tradeoffs to get there.
What we are looking for in the role
  • 6-10+ years of professional experience in software engineering.
  • Strong desire to lead, execute, and own their own projects.
  • Track record of learning new languages, technologies, and patterns on the job.
  • Comfortable working and reasoning across the stack - frontend, backend, and infrastructure.
  • Willingness to work a hybrid schedule with a minimum of 3 days in-office.
What would set you apart
  • Experience at an early-stage startup
  • Experience with DOM parsing and manipulation
  • Familiarity with LLM APIs and experience using them in a production environment
  • Experience with any of our tech stack: Express+NodeJS, PostgreSQL, MongoDB, Playwright, FFmpeg, GCP
